What is your opinion on Gothitelle & Gothorita suspect?
Goth is neither broken nor uncompetitive but it is unhealthy because of how it restricts certain builds. I definitely wanted it gone but apparently most people didn't so its w/e
Are there any elements of the metagame that you deem unhealthy?
As mentioned before, Gothitelle, but also Geomancy. No matter how the meta shifts it still remains a dangerous threat that greatly reduces the viability of threats such as Palkia, Rayquaza, and other offensive Dragon-types. With more of these in play I feel like Primal Groudon would also be easier for teams to check offensively. Z Geomancy is also just broken.

What are your advices for new players getting into Ubers?
People like to diss the ladder but it's a great place to learn the tier because you can get a ton of games in a short amount of time. There's a reason many prominent players started out on the ladder so just grab a sample or build a team and start playing. Don't care about your ranking because that's how people go mad.

Would you provide us with a team and add a brief description?
MERCILESS (Deoxys-Attack) @ Life Orb
Ability: Pressure
EVs: 4 Def / 252 SpA / 252 Spe
Modest Nature
IVs: 0 Atk
- Nasty Plot
- Psycho Boost
- Ice Beam
- Psyshock
CONQUERER (Ho-Oh) @ Life Orb
Ability: Regenerator
EVs: 248 HP / 252 Atk / 8 Def
Brave Nature
- Sacred Fire
- Brave Bird
- Defog
- Toxic
VENDETTA (Marshadow) @ Marshadium Z
Ability: Technician
EVs: 252 Atk / 4 Def / 252 Spe
Jolly Nature
- Spectral Thief
- Close Combat
- Bulk Up
- Shadow Sneak
MALIGNANT (Groudon-Primal) @ Red Orb
Ability: Desolate Land
EVs: 252 HP / 4 Def / 252 SpD
Careful Nature
- Stealth Rock
- Roar
- Lava Plume
- Precipice Blades
EXTORTION (Arceus-Fairy) @ Pixie Plate
Ability: Multitype
EVs: 252 HP / 64 Def / 192 Spe
Timid Nature
IVs: 0 Atk
- Recover
- Judgment
- Fire Blast
- Toxic
BLACKGUARD (Giratina) @ Leftovers
Ability: Pressure
EVs: 252 HP / 252 Def / 4 SpD
Impish Nature
IVs: 0 Atk
- Rest
- Will-O-Wisp
- Defog
- Toxic

I built this team to use vs Evuelf during week 2 of UPL expecting him to bring stall but it did better vs other matchups than I initially expected such as balance and even offense if you play it right. It has a Deoxys-A bc I just slap it on 90% of my teams and Psyshock was used to deal w blobs and occasionally Ho-oh/Magearna but Dark Pulse can work too. Marshadow is generally pretty deadly for stall and the dual defog helps keep rocks off while Giratina helps with the stall matchup. Fairyceus deals with Dark-types and Fire Blast is there bc too many people think steel-types are good switchins to this.
